Arrowhead Pharmaceuticals Inc is a commercial-stage pharmaceutical company. It is focused on the development of medicines for diseases associated with genetic abnormalities or protein overproduction. The company develops potential RNAi therapies designed to inhibit the expression of genes known to trigger diseases. Its portfolio includes potential drugs targeting Cardiometabolic, Neuromuscular, Pulmonary, Liver, and other diseases. The company also develops RNAi products and clinical candidates designed to target different cell types within the body.
Based in Minnesota, Bio-Techne is a life sciences manufacturer supplying consumables and instruments for the pharma, biotech, academic, and diagnostic markets. It reports in two segments: protein sciences (about 75% of revenue) and diagnostics and genomics (25%). The protein sciences segment sells reagents and analytical instruments used in life sciences research, including antibodies used in protein analysis. The diagnostics and genomics segment sells diagnostic reagents, molecular diagnostics, and spatial biology products. The United States accounts for about 55% of revenue. The firm also has operations in Europe, the Middle East, and Africa (20% of sales), the UK (5%), and Asia-Pacific (15%), with the rest of the world accounting for the remaining 5%.
